Sei sulla pagina 1di 28

Business Objects

Agenda

 List of Values
 Hierarchies
 Aggregate Awarenes
Universe Design
List of Values (LOV)
What is a List of Values?

 A list of the distinct values from the column or


columns to which the object refers
 A LoV is used on the operand side of a condition in
the query panel of the User module

 This is only available if set by the designer


Creating a List of Values
Creating a List of Values
Creating a List of Values
Creating a List of Values
How do Lists of Values work?

 A designer can create a LoV which is based on:

 A query of the target database

 A constant set of values held in a file

 In both cases, the result is stored locally in a file on


the User ’s PC.
Creating a List of Values

 A LoV is created within the Properties tab of an object

 By default,
Associate a List
and Allow Users to
edit are checked:
 It is important to
uncheck this box
for objects that
don’t need a List
Controlling How Lists are Refreshed

 Normally, the first time a LoV is used in a User login


session, the system fires a query at the target
database.
 The results of this query are used to populate the list,
and are stored in the .lov file.
 Thereafter, the .lov file from this query is used each
time the List is required.
Controlling How Lists are Refreshed
(continued)

 Not normally used -


uncheck this box

 Check this box for


frequently changing lists

 Check this box for edited


lists
Modifying the Content of a List of Values

 You can limit the values returned by applying a


condition to the LoV

 You can simplify the process of choosing a value for


Users by creating a hierarchy for the LoV

 You can supply a personal data file containing the


values for the list, instead of using the results of the
query
Applying a Condition to a List of Values

 Click Edit in the Properties box:


 Apply the condition in the Query
Panel:
Applying a Condition to a List of Values

 Click Edit in the Properties box:


 Apply the condition in the Query
Panel:
Creating a Hierarchy for a List of Values

 Make sure the hierarchy exists


for the object
Creating a Hierarchy for a List of Values
Creating a Hierarchy for a List of Values
Creating a Hierarchy for a List of Values

 Click Edit in the Properties box:


 Place the hierarchy objects (which
must be sorted) to the right of the
LoV object in the Query Panel:
Creating a Hierarchy for a List of Values
Creating a Hierarchy for a List of Values
Creating a Hierarchy for a List of Values
Creating a Hierarchy for a List of Values

Country
Region

City
Creating a Hierarchy for a List of Values
Basing a LoV on a Personal File

 Select Tools, Lists of Values from the Menu bar:

 Select the object:

 Select Personal Data:


Basing a LoV on a Personal File (continued)

 Click OK to acknowledge the message:

 Specify the file that contains the values for the list
and click OK
Basing a LoV on a Personal File (continued)

 Specify the file that contains the values for the list
and click OK
Basing a LoV on a Personal File (continued)

Potrebbero piacerti anche